Mineral Resources (ASX:MIN) share price drops 6% despite lithium guidance upgrade

Mineral Resources Ltd shares fell 6.3% to A$57.15 Friday after reporting a 29% jump in spodumene prices and raising lithium output forecasts. The S&P/ASX 200 dropped 0.65%, with lithium stocks hit hard as prices slid 11% in Asia. Net debt fell to about A$4.9 billion, and cash liquidity topped A$1.4 billion. Broker ratings diverged, with Macquarie upgrading to outperform and Jarden warning on costs.

PLS Group share price: why ASX:PLS slid on its quarterly update — and what to watch next week

PLS Group shares fell 6.5% to A$4.29 Friday after a major shareholder, GFL International, sold 32.19 million shares in a block trade. The company posted a 49% revenue jump to A$373 million last quarter, with lithium prices surging but unit costs up 8%. The board will decide by March on restarting the Ngungaju plant, which could resume output within four months.

Cisco stock price slips into weekend as Fed pick jitters hit tech — what CSCO investors watch next

Cisco shares closed at $78.32 Friday, down 0.1%, as U.S. markets fell after Donald Trump nominated Kevin Warsh to lead the Federal Reserve and producer prices rose more than expected. Investors shifted away from risk ahead of next week’s U.S. jobs report and Cisco’s earnings release. The stock is up 5% over the past week. Treasury yields and the dollar climbed as bets on near-term rate cuts faded.

Goldman Sachs (GS) stock slips on Warsh Fed pick and shutdown jitters — what to know before Monday

Goldman Sachs closed down 0.5% at $935.41 after a volatile session Friday, with shares trading between $923.17 and $947.00 on 1.8 million volume. Donald Trump nominated Kevin Warsh as Fed chair, seen as a hawkish pick. A partial U.S. government shutdown loomed as the Senate passed a spending bill but the House remained out until Monday. U.S. stocks broadly slipped amid inflation and shutdown concerns.

Corning stock price steadies after Meta AI cable deal; analysts warn on near-term constraints (GLW)

Corning shares rose 0.24% to $103.25 Friday after Meta confirmed a $6 billion supply deal for fiber-optic cable through 2030. Corning reported fourth-quarter core sales up 14% to $4.41 billion and forecast first-quarter core sales above analyst expectations. Brokerages raised price targets but flagged near-term capacity constraints. U.S. markets are closed for the weekend.

Texas Instruments stock slips into the weekend after AI-led surge; what TXN watchers track next

Texas Instruments shares fell 1.5% to $215.55 Friday, retreating after a post-earnings rally. The company forecast first-quarter revenue and profit above analyst estimates and reported a 70% jump in data-center revenue. The board declared a $1.42 quarterly dividend, payable Feb. 10 to shareholders of record Jan. 30. Chip stocks broadly declined as Wall Street indexes ended lower.

Amphenol stock slips again after earnings whipsaw — what APH investors watch next week

Amphenol shares fell 3.68% Friday to $144.08, closing about 13.75% below their Jan. 27 high after a volatile week following earnings. Trading volume hit 12 million shares, down from nearly 38 million on earnings day. The company reported Q4 sales up 49% to $6.4 billion and forecast Q1 sales as high as $7 billion, including contributions from its CommScope CCS acquisition.

Charter Communications stock jumps 7.6% after earnings ease broadband-loss fears — what to watch Monday

Charter Communications shares closed up 7.6% at $206.12 Friday after reporting smaller-than-expected broadband subscriber losses but missing revenue and mobile growth estimates. The company lost 119,000 internet customers in Q4, less than the 131,970 forecast, while revenue fell 2% to $13.60 billion. Charter projects $11.4 billion in 2026 capital spending and reported $94.6 billion in debt.

RELX shares fell 4.6% to 2,145p on Friday, near a 52-week low, despite the FTSE 100 closing higher. The company disclosed a new buyback of 465,361 shares on Feb. 6 and has repurchased over 8.8 million shares since Jan. 2. Investors await RELX’s full-year 2025 results on Feb. 12 amid concerns over AI’s impact on its core business.

Glencore shares closed up 0.6% at 478.10 pence Friday after Rio Tinto ended merger talks, issuing a “no intention to bid” statement. Glencore’s board rejected the proposed deal terms, citing concerns over valuation and governance. Attention now turns to possible asset sales, including its $5 billion Kazzinc stake, ahead of Glencore’s annual results on Feb. 18.
